The product itself I liked, it stays on and it's a nice color (this is the brown). I'm returning mine however because (like everyone elses'), the thing REFUSES to sharpen, it breaks off into pieces and chunks. I tried two different sharpeners and it did no good. I gave up, but if I had kept trying it would've been down to nothing. Save the $$.

This is another weird eyeliner from Sephora. I have this in matte black. I like that the color isn't your usual full dramatic black. This pencil is waterproof, but still tends to smudge and run into the corners of the eye after a few hours of wear. It sharpens easily and applies smoothly, yet it applies oddly. I don't feel I get a really tight line with this liner. I try to get as close to my lash line as possible, but the line always looks weird. I think the trouble with this liner is where you apply it is where it goes. You don't have much wiggle room after you apply even when you try to use the attached smudge brush. Urban Decay waterproof eyeliners are a great example of waterproof e/l's that give you about 30 seconds of wiggle room to fix a smudge or push the liner into the right place. I wish this liner allowed you that because then it would be a really great liner. At $8 a piece, it's half the cost of the UD, but it's almost not worth it. I will try and use this up, but I'm going back to the UD after this.
